# Break-Glass: Catalog Cache Invalidation

Scope: the Pinrow product catalog at Veldstone Retail. If stale prices persist after a purge and the Hollowmere invalidation queue is wedged, use break-glass to flush the edge tier directly. Contractors: get verbal sign-off from the catalog lead first. Steps: open the Hollowmere admin shell, select emergency-flush, confirm the tenant, and run it once — repeated flushes thrash the origin. Access is logged and expires after 20 minutes. Unseal the admin shell with the passphrase below.

recovery phrase for kahop-tajog: istix-casvan

**Audit item 14: Leaked file descriptor hunt.** Before closing this item, verify that the Fennwick ingest daemon releases every descriptor after a batch run. New team members: run the descriptor census script twice, once under load and once idle, and compare counts. Any delta above zero means a leak somewhere in the retry path — check the socket pool first, since that's where past leaks hid. Record your findings in the audit log. The engineer accountable for this check is named below.

approver of yawig-yajef = Briius Jorix

Key ceremony checklist, item 4 (Glimmerpress incremental rebuilds): Plugin authors must confirm their build hooks are registered against the new signing key before the ceremony concludes, since incremental static site rebuilds will reject artifacts signed with the retired key. Verify that partial-rebuild manifests resolve correctly against your plugin's content fingerprints, and run one dry rebuild in the staging mirror. Once verified, initial the ledger; the escrow recovery passphrase for your plugin slot is recorded immediately below.

vault phrase of bagaf-kajeg = jorath-feniel-briir-siliel-ralix

Several plugin authors reported intermittent `NXDOMAIN` errors when their Bramblehook plugins call the Veldora resolver. Investigation shows the sandbox image ships with a stale resolver config pointing at a decommissioned node, so lookups succeed only when the fallback path is hit. We've published a patched base image; plugin authors should rebuild against it. Until then, the workaround is to route lookups through the authenticated resolver proxy by adding this line to your sandbox env file:

env line for fafof-fahag: LEDGER_TOKEN5=f8790